Output 32669699f60d653ac2a12a564725d179f0d920b58e8a18ca55e36a2bf0d314f9:1

value
453629
script pubkey
OP_0 OP_PUSHBYTES_20 40951af896aa877ad18d98fbf973055d88bec5b9
address
ltc1qgz2347yk42rh45vdnraljuc9tkyta3demdygsw
transaction
32669699f60d653ac2a12a564725d179f0d920b58e8a18ca55e36a2bf0d314f9
spent
true